How is computer science used in bioinformatics?

In bioinformatics, computer science provides tools and methods for analyzing biological data, such as DNA, RNA, and protein sequences. It involves developing algorithms, databases, and software to interpret large datasets, enabling discoveries in genomics, drug development, and personalized medicine. Skills in programming, data structures, and computational modeling are essential for bioinformatics roles.

What are the key skills and qualifications needed to thrive in the Computer Science Bioinformatics position, and why are they important?

To thrive in Computer Science Bioinformatics, you need a solid background in computer science, biology, and statistics, often supported by a relevant degree or advanced certification. Proficiency in programming languages such as Python, R, and experience with bioinformatics tools and databases like BLAST, GenBank, and cloud platforms are highly valuable. Strong analytical thinking, problem-solving abilities, and effective communication are essential soft skills for this interdisciplinary field. These skills allow professionals to efficiently analyze complex biological data, collaborate with cross-functional teams, and contribute to critical discoveries in healthcare and biotechnology.

What is a Computer Science Bioinformatics job?

A Computer Science Bioinformatics job involves using computational techniques to analyze and interpret biological data, such as DNA sequences, protein structures, and genomic information. Professionals in this field develop algorithms, software tools, and databases to support biological research and medical advancements. They work in areas like genomics, drug discovery, and personalized medicine, often collaborating with biologists, chemists, and healthcare professionals. Strong programming skills, data analysis expertise, and knowledge of biology are essential for success in this field.

Job Summary:
CooperSurgical is dedicated to developing and maintaining cutting-edge software solutions for the Life Sciences product portfolio. As a Staff Bioinformatics Software Engineer, you will lead the design and development of innovative digital solutions, focusing on high throughput next generation sequencing data and analysis platforms. This role involves collaborating with a multidisciplinary team to enhance existing offerings and develop new software products.
Responsibilities:
• Lead the design and development of new features and enhancements for Cooper Bioinformatics products and applications, as well as new products and initiatives to meet the evolving needs of our business.
• Play a pivotal role as a Bioinformatics Software Development subject matter expert, demonstrating deep expertise in analyzing and interpreting biological data using statistical and computational techniques.
• Collaborate with biologists to design experiments and analyze data outcomes
• Work on algorithm development for sequence analysis, gene prediction, and other applications
• Drive the evolution of software development practices, including identifying opportunities for automation, efficiency, and innovation.
• Mentor and guide junior engineers, fostering their growth and development.
• Collaborate with the team to set the direction of future development within current and future CSI projects, contributing to architectural decisions and technical strategy.
Qualifications:
Required:
• Minimum of 7 years of relevant experience, with track record of increase in responsibilities and leadership within the software development field.
• Minimum bachelor’s degree in computer science, bioinformatics, data science, mathematics, statistics or related field.
• Extensive experience in NGS algorithms and analysis pipeline development, including data workflows, processing pipelines, and bioinformatics file formats (FASTQ, SAM/BAM, VCF).
• Strong experience in the design and optimization of targeted NGS panels, genome assemblies, and statistical modeling.
• Extensive experience in high-level scripting languages used in bioinformatics, such as R or Python, with a proven track record of delivering complex, high-quality software solutions.
• Extensive experience with the Linux operating system and its terminal commands. Knowledge of Bash scripting is a strong plus.
• Extensive knowledge of common bioinformatics toolkits, including Bowtie 2, BWA, GATK, SAMtools, and FastQC.
• Strong understanding of AWS cloud solutions, including S3, RDS, and EC2.
• Familiarity with pipeline development tools such as Snakemake and Nextflow.
• Strong experience with Git version control and software development best practices, including writing clean, maintainable code and designing modular, reusable components.
• Familiarity with unit testing and test-driven development (TDD) methodologies to ensure high code quality and reliability.
• Familiarity with containerization technologies such as Docker, as well as package management tools like Conda.
• Knowledge of statistical methods such as Hidden Markov Models, along with a strong foundation in linear algebra, is a strong plus.
• Familiarity with modern GPU-accelerated frameworks, such as NVIDIA Parabricks, is a strong plus.
• Outcome-focused mindset with strong process discipline and a commitment to timely project delivery.
• Strong interpersonal and communication skills, with the ability to collaborate effectively and mentor team members.
• Strong commitment to continuous learning and staying current with emerging technologies.
